[−][src]Struct snarkos_polycommit::kzg10::Powers
Powers
is used to commit to and create evaluation proofs for a given
polynomial.
Fields
powers_of_g: Cow<'a, [E::G1Affine]>
Group elements of the form β^i G
, for different values of i
.
powers_of_gamma_g: Cow<'a, [E::G1Affine]>
Group elements of the form β^i γG
, for different values of i
.
